Senior Vianney Martinez will be given the opportunity to be featured in the Voyager artchive. Her art has been around the library and a part of the Voyager newspaper before.
When Martinez graduates, she will be attending Pomona University in California. “I’m still not fully decided on my major, but I plan to double major in cognitive science, digital media, or art. I do plan to continue making art in the future, in whatever way possible,” she said.
Martinez showcased fun projects during her time at H-F, “I’ve been doing art at H-F for 3 years, I started my sophomore year.”
She also contributed to making decorations for Día de Los Muertos and Hispanic Heritage Month in and around the library.
“I’d say my photoshoot with one of my close friends, Briea Levant, is currently my favorite. I did a photoshoot of her in a dress I designed and created, made and dyed all the props, and did her makeup for this photoshoot,” shared Martinez.
Martinez explained what her favorite moment was during high school with the photos of her friend. “ I spent months on it and hand-painted the frame I printed out the photo on.”
